Reset takes a closer look at local calls to remove a Christopher Columbus statue from Grant Park. Dozens were injured Friday during a violent clash between police and protesters who tried to tear the statue down.

GUEST: Ald. Rosanna Rodriguez Sanchez, 33rd Ward
